Evolution of weakly correlated systems
I. N. Kosarev The Institute on Laser and Information Technologies of the Russian Academy of Sciences
Abstract:
A propagator with an effective action is constructed for a quantum many-particle system in the approximation taking into account only pair correlations between particles. The theory can easily be generalized to the case of two species of particles. In the case of a rarefied plasma and a gas, this propagator for a one-particle density matrix provides a solution to the kinetic problem over time intervals longer than the relaxation time.
